Rough-In Plumbing Phase:
The underground phase of new construction plumbing involves establishing the fundamental infrastructure that will serve the property for decades. Sewer line connection and main drain installation require precise planning to ensure proper slope and adequate capacity. This work must be completed before foundation pouring, making accuracy crucial from the start.
Water service line installation from the meter to the home establishes the primary water system connection. This process involves coordination with local utilities and adherence to specific depth and protection requirements. The installation must account for future maintenance access while protecting the lines from damage.
Foundation plumbing considerations include proper sealing and support for pipes that pass through concrete. These details may seem minor but can prevent costly issues later in the building’s life.
In-Wall Plumbing Rough-In:
The in-wall rough-in phase involves installing hot water and cold water supply lines throughout the structure. This work requires careful measurement and planning to ensure fixtures will align properly during the finish phase. The routing of these lines must consider both functionality and future maintenance access.
Drain, waste, and vent (DWV) system installation represents one of the most complex aspects of new construction plumbing. The system must provide adequate drainage while maintaining proper venting to prevent sewer gases from entering the building. This requires understanding gravity drainage principles and local code requirements.
Pipe sizing and proper slope requirements ensure optimal system performance. Experienced plumber teams calculate these specifications based on fixture units and local codes, ensuring the system will handle peak demand without issues.

Drainage and Waste Systems:
Understanding gravity drainage principles is fundamental to proper system design. The plumbing company must ensure adequate slope throughout the drainage system while maintaining proper support for all piping.
Vent stack installation and requirements ensure proper system operation by preventing vacuum conditions that could impede drainage. These vents also prevent sewer gases from entering the building, protecting occupant health and comfort.
Cleanout access points provide essential maintenance access for future service needs. Strategic placement of these access points can prevent costly repairs and minimize disruption when maintenance is required.

Plumbing Material Options:
Pipe Materials Comparison:
Modern new construction plumbing offers several pipe material options, each with distinct advantages. PEX piping provides flexibility and freeze resistance, making it popular for residential homes. Copper offers durability and proven performance but at higher material costs. PVC remains the standard for drainage applications due to its chemical resistance and longevity.
Cost analysis and longevity considerations help property owners make informed decisions about material selection. While initial costs vary, long-term performance and maintenance requirements often influence the best choice for each application. Local code requirements and restrictions may limit material options in some areas. Professional plumbing services providers stay current on these requirements to ensure compliance and avoid costly corrections.

Quality Assurance and Testing:
Pressure testing procedures verify the integrity of the entire water system. These tests identify any leaks or weak points before the system is put into service, preventing damage and ensuring reliability. Leak detection methods include both visual inspection and pressure testing. Modern techniques can identify even small leaks that might not be immediately apparent but could cause problems over time.
System flushing and sanitization ensure that the water system is clean and safe for use. This process removes any debris or contaminants that may have entered during construction. Final inspection preparation involves reviewing all work to ensure it meets project specifications and building codes. This thorough review prevents delays and ensures successful project completion.
